5. **Generator Elegance**: Generators provide memory-efficient magic. They produce values on-the-fly, saving memory. For instance, `gen = (x**2 for x in range(3))` creates a generator for squaring numbers. Use `next(gen)` to unveil their power! #PythonGenerators

Step 3️⃣: CPU Efficiency #CPUPerformance #PythonGenerators #Optimization Generators allow lazy evaluation, meaning they calculate values only when needed. This optimizes CPU performance, reducing unnecessary calculations. Perfect for heavy computational tasks! ⚙️🔥
